Top 5 Pirate Games on iOS in Finland: Q1 2025 Insights
Explore the performance of the top five pirate-themed games on iOS in Finland during Q1 2025, with insights on down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the first quarter of 2025, the pirate-themed gaming category on iOS in Finland saw interesting trends across the top five apps. Here's a detailed look at their performance based on Sensor Tower data.
Sea of Conquest: Pirate War from FunPlus International AG experienced fluctuations in weekly revenue, peaking at about $2.7K in early March before ending the quarter around $2.5K. Downloads peaked mid-February at 48, while active users showed a downward trend from 345 in January to 111 by the end of March.
Return to Monkey Island by Devolver had a modest revenue stream with minor peaks, reaching $58 in early February. Downloads were minimal throughout the quarter, and active users gradually decreased from 250 to 190.
Pirate Kings™ by Playtika LTD saw revenue peaking at $368 in January, but it declined to $50 by the end of March. Downloads remained low, while active users hovered around 16, eventually dropping to 10.
Bounty Bash from Limebolt Inc generated a revenue high of $103 in mid-January, but it tapered off to $13 by March's end. Downloads were sparse, with no significant activity after late January.
Lastly, Pirate Raid: Caribbean Battle by SayGames LTD showed minor revenue fluctuations, peaking at $43 in early February. Downloads were limited, with a small increase in March, while active users remained stable at around four or five.
